Output 5288b607933555f48b01a3e0dc7cc3d3fcb20e7c18bf59bfbdb8974e28220023:378

value
1411856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 889575715e8f1fd46e7554bd27fdcae7bcc162da OP_EQUALVERIFY OP_CHECKSIG
address
1DTBwfcTq39gbXG1srJqkK8R88sWPKP5vD
transaction
5288b607933555f48b01a3e0dc7cc3d3fcb20e7c18bf59bfbdb8974e28220023
confirmations
651954
spent
true